About the Company:Our client is a rapidly growing manufacturing organization who are looking to add a bilingual Spanish HR Generalist to their team. The organization has enjoyed incredible success in the last few years' and are seeking a candidate with a similar background to join the team in this role. The ideal candidate would come from a blue collar manufacturing background and have experience with payroll and union staff. Closely coordinate various Human Resource processes with V.P.'s and managers. Benefit & Compensation- Administer payroll processing, leave mgmt/attendance, health insurance open enrollment. Recruitment- source candidates and Onboarding- guide new hires through orientation. H.R. Initiatives: 1. W- Create, maintain and update all hourly and salaried employees' records in the system including payroll information, vacation accruals/usage and personal days. Coordinate out of ordinary issues with supervisors and document if necessary. 2. W- Coordinate, audit and edit payroll reports accounting for all time worked and any non-worked hours such as vacation, personal or sick time. 3. W- Process weekly payroll by entering time sheets and pulling timekeeping system information totals into the payroll computer system. 4. W- Calculate and process total hours to be paid to associates (temp employees) and send figures to Temp Agency. Verify payroll figures/calculations received from outside sources. 5. W- Upload 401K information from the payroll system and verify that the information is correct. - Backup 6. W- Maintain payroll check integrity- Sort and distribute paychecks, and when requested mail checks to employees off work. 7. M- Calculate and track all deductions for benefits, wage assignments or garnishments. Monitor special circumstances files. 8. M- File Management- of Employee files, OSHA Logs, Workers Comp claims, Union Grievances, Health, Life, Vision, Long-Term Disability. Maintain proper file separations. 9. M- Assist identifying safety issues in the plant through Safety committee audit initiatives and report findings along with pictures to Plant Supervisor. 10. M- Report Safety issues to Plant Mgr that are recommended by OSHA, City Inspectors, Insurance auditors and Other internal or external safety reports. 11. M- Develop, maintain & update various payroll related reports such as 401(k) payouts, union dues & insurance premium reports. 12. W- Weekly attendance report to department manager 13. M- Keep all Job Descriptions updated. 14. AN- Keep on file production prepared employee skill sets spreadsheet. Review quarterly with plant manager. H.R. Initiatives - continued: 15. AN- Administer various benefit packages, conduct enrollments, process changes of status, calculate premiums, review claims reports and assist employees with insurance benefit/policy and claims questions. 16. A- Coordinate employee/supervisor 360 performance evaluation program, coordinate with supervisors/managers of evaluations, attendance and any recognitions or write-ups during the year, then filing completed forms. 17. A- Prepare Annual Salary/Benefits booklets for office personnel for 1st week in February distribution. 18. A- Prepare and submit Annual OSHA Form 300 in a timely manner. 19. AN- Assist in Union Contract Agreement negotiations. 20. AN- Year of Union Contract Negotiations- In March/April Prepare an Annual Wage/Benefits booklet summary for plant employees. 21.
